Under these rules, a player finishing 11th in a LIV Golf event is treated the same as a player finishing 57th. Limiting points to only the top 10 finishers disproportionately harms players who consistently perform at a high level but finish just outside that threshold, as well as emerging talent working to establish themselves on the world stage\u2014precisely the players a fair and meritocratic ranking system is designed to recognize.<\/p>\n<p>No other competitive tour or league in OWGR history has been subjected to such a restriction. We expect this is merely a first step toward a structure that fully and fairly serves the players, the fans, and the future of the sport.<\/p>\n<p>We entered this process in good faith and will continue to advocate for a ranking system that reflects performance over affiliation.
